Output 26eef546bc1039fb3f85bb7c570234b788988510523b0118b150ac31b12f6208:74

value
17484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df143c57d850db82b63d43e6a59515255fbf965 OP_EQUAL
address
34RLYUTqZgKiuexDyqRmnaYNM5DBSTqyTD
transaction
26eef546bc1039fb3f85bb7c570234b788988510523b0118b150ac31b12f6208